Abstract
In this paper we suggest the use of the forward-looking geometry with the Radar mounted in the front of a vehicle. In order to assess the feasibility of this measurement geometry, we have performed an extensive series of measurements in an anechoic chamber. Results show that the forward looking geometry is appropriate for the detection of buried landmines.
